It was very sad to learn of the death of the greatest racehorse trainer off all-time yesterday. When you read what Vincent O'Brien achieved it is simply staggering. The word legend is overused but it undeniably applies to Dr O'Brien whose record is unlikely to ever be equalled. He won the Derby six times and will be remembered at Epsom on Saturday where it is likely a horse from the yard he created, Ballydoyle, will win the Derby.

When the market opened last night Monaadema (7.50) at Folkstone was offered at [2.4] to back. I thought that was a bit of value and clearly I was not alone as she is now trading at [1.75]. William Haggas' filly looks very well handicapped from an official mark of 78 and has been well supported in early trading. Although she has not run for 348 days, following an impressive maiden victory, she will represent a stable in very good form. In the last 14 days the yard has sent out 17 runners and with seven winners has a strike rate of 41%. It would be no surprise to see Monaadema, the subject of good reports from Newmarket, enhance those statistics this evening.
At a more sporting price Excusez Moi (3.30) is one of six course and distance winners in this field of nine at Ripon. Ruth Carr is proving herself a very capable young trainer, having taken over from her grandfather David Chapman at the North Yorkshire yard that has done well with sprinters over the years. Excusez Moi is in good form with three wins from his last five starts and is back in handicap company after a last gasp win of a conditions event last time at Beverley. Running off 95 today the seven year-old is has won from marks of 96 and 99 when with Clive Brittain. I expect Excusez Moi to confirm his wellbeing with a win in Ripon's feature race this afternoon.
